Marquette County residents thanked

To the Journal editor:

The Marquette County Salvation Army Advisory Board would like to thank you, the people of Marquette County, for your unwavering support that allowed so many families in this county to experience Christmas for and with their families.

Because of your generosity, 272 families representing 657 children received 8,122 gifts including, bicycles, gift cards, clothing, puzzles, books, art supplies, dolls, trucks, balls, stuffed animals, small stocking stuffers, and a box of food through the Salvation Army Christmas toy shop.

Beyond that, we had gifts for shut-ins and nursing home residents. Some of you gave money through the red kettles or the mail.

Some of you gave time as you volunteered to man the kettles, standing in the cold, and ringing the bells so others could donate. Some of you donated toys, clothing, food, and all the other items we could give out.

We are grateful to all of you and know that every gift you gave, large or small, in whatever form, was gratefully received, both by The Salvation Army and the families who benefited.

Thank you.
